Job description

Lead complex power and automation solutions that shape critical infrastructure

Schneider Electric is looking for a Technical Lead – Electrical Engineering Specialist to join our Power Systems Hub Canada. In this role, you will be at the heart of technically complex and high‑impact projects, providing leadership and expertise from tendering through execution.

You’ll work closely with project managers, tender managers, sales teams, and application centers, contributing to solutions across electrical distribution, control, and process automation—with a strong presence in industries such as Data Centers, Utilities, Mining, Renewables, Transportation, Water & Wastewater, and Marine.

This is a great opportunity for a senior electrical engineer who enjoys technical ownership, customer interaction, and influencing solution architecture.

Responsibilities
  • Own the end‑to‑end technical execution of medium to large projects, from proposal to delivery
  • Serve as a technical authority for power systems and distribution solutions
  • Influence solution design, optimization, and innovation for complex customer environments
  • Lead without hierarchy by collaborating and mentoring across multidisciplinary teams
What you will do
  • Provide technical leadership during tendering and project execution phases
  • Support sales teams by delivering optimized and compliant power system designs
  • Define technical architectures and ensure engineering quality and integrity
  • Lead and coordinate with engineers, contractors, consultants, and application centers
  • Independently manage smaller projects without direct project management oversight
  • Evaluate proposals, technical studies, and designs; identify risks and mitigation strategies
  • Develop engineering estimates, bid documentation, and technical customer presentations
  • Support facility upgrades for power, control, and automation systems
  • Act as a technical ambassador for medium‑ and low‑voltage switchgear and switchboards
Qualifications
Required
  • Bachelor’s degree in Electrical Engineering
  • Professional Engineer designation (P.Eng.) in Canada
  • 5+ years of progressive experience in electrical distribution, including MV/LV systems
  • Strong capability in electrical distribution design and power systems engineeringExperience leading or coordinating multidisciplinary engineering teams
  • Ability to work independently and provide sound technical judgment
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ills
Assets
  • Experience with control systems or process automation
  • Background in complex or regulated industries (data centers, utilities, mining, etc.)
  • Experience with project proposals, customer presentations, and technical negotiations
Additional Details
  • Ability to travel up to 30% across Canada, the U.S., and Mexico
  • Availability for occasional after‑hours or weekend work, depending on customer needs
  • Comfortable working under pressure in fast‑paced project environments
